Greenplum alter table add partition

WebThe ALTER TABLE...ADD PARTITION command adds a partition to an existing partitioned table. The number of defined partitions in a partitioned table is not limited. New … WebJun 22, 2010 · altering the type of the column will trigger a table rewrite, so the row versioning isn't a big problem, but it will still take lots of disk space temporarily. you can usually monitor progress by looking at which files in the database directory are being appended to... Share Improve this answer Follow edited Jun 22, 2010 at 20:42 …

Карманный справочник: сравнение синтаксиса MS SQL Server и PostgreSQL

WebThe Greenplum system catalog stores partition hierarchy information so that rows inserted into the top-level parent table propagate correctly to the child table partitions. To … dark green adirondack chairs https://speconindia.com

pg_upgrade Checks

WebFeb 9, 2024 · This form adds a new PRIMARY KEY or UNIQUE constraint to a table based on an existing unique index. All the columns of the index will be included in the constraint. The index cannot have expression columns nor be a partial index. Also, it must be a b-tree index with default sort ordering. WebDescription. ALTER TABLE changes the definition of an existing table. There are several subforms: ADD COLUMN — Adds a new column to the table, using the same syntax as CREATE TABLE.The ENCODING clause is valid only for append-optimized, column-oriented tables. WebFeb 1, 2009 · Adding a New Partition in Greenplum Adding a New Partition You can add a new partition to an existing partition design using the ALTER TABLE command. If … dark green aesthetic glow

Automatic partitioning by day - PostgreSQL - Stack Overflow

Category:ALTER TABLE...ADD PARTITION - PolarDB for PostgreSQL…

Tags:Greenplum alter table add partition

Greenplum alter table add partition

ALTER TABLE ADD PARTITION - Amazon Athena

WebThis is happening because you are trying to alter the table to add partitions when there is a cursor open (active select) on the table. The required locks conflict. You can fix that by first fetching the partition dates into an array, close the cursor and then create partitions from that array. Code sample is below. WebOct 1, 2024 · Greenplum add multiple partitions by range to existing table. can't wrap my mind around adding partitions to the existing partitioned table in Pivotal Greenplum via …

Greenplum alter table add partition

Did you know?

WebNov 1, 2014 · 3 ways to backup Greenplum database 4 parameters used to configure and monitor disk space alerts using emc call home feature A simple shell script to … WebIf you run an ALTER TABLE ADD PARTITION statement and mistakenly specify a partition that already exists and an incorrect Amazon S3 location, zero byte placeholder …

WebJun 7, 2024 · CREATE TABLE ti (id INT, amount DECIMAL (7,2), tr_date DATE) ENGINE=INNODB PARTITION BY HASH ( MONTH (tr_date) ) PARTITIONS 6; References: http://dev.mysql.com/doc/refman/5.6/en/partitioning-overview.html Trigger-based First attempts to support auto-partitioning have been made using triggers. WebApr 11, 2024 · 1- Creating automatic partion depends on the date range of insert command 2- In script i have also mentioned that how we can add index on the required column's. 3- Data from date range from 1st to 14th will be added in partition "p1" and remaining will be added in partition "p2". Sample Script :

WebMar 1, 2009 · Modifying a Subpartition Template in Greenplum Use ALTER TABLE SET SUBPARTITION TEMPLATE to modify the subpartition template for an existing partition. After you set a new subpartition template, partitions that you add subsequently will have the new subpartition design. Existing partitions are not modified. Webto the stated table naming convention WHEN partition_plan='day' THEN 'YYYY-MM-DD' Then the SQL query that calls the function to perform the cleanup can be called from a daily maintenance script like this: SELECT public.drop_partitions (current_date-180, …

WebAug 13, 2024 · CREATE TABLE sale_202402 PARTITION OF sale FOR VALUES FROM ('2024-02-01') TO ('2024-03-01'); You added two partitions, one for January 2024 and another for February 2024. This way of creating partitions is called “declarative partitioning.” Prior to Postgres 10, only EDB Postgres Advanced Server provided …

WebPostgres Pro Enterprise Postgres Pro Standard Cloud Solutions Postgres Extensions. ... and have a default partition, now we want to add a new partition and move the data from default partition to new added partition. ... Alter table only wbxdata attach partition wbxdata_p2305 for values from ‘‘2024-05-01 00:00:00’ TO ‘2024-06-01 00:00: ... dark green acrylic paintWebAdding a Default Partition in Greenplum You can add a default partition to an existing partition design using the ALTER TABLE command. ALTER TABLE sales ADD … dark green aesthetic collagehttp://www.dbaref.com/adding-a-new-partition-in-greenplum bishop brent the shipWebPostgres Pro Enterprise Postgres Pro Standard Cloud Solutions Postgres Extensions. ... and have a > default partition, now we want to add a new partition and move the data from > default partition to new added partition. > > Begin; > Alter table only wbxdata … detach partition wbxdata_pdefault; ---from here, accessexclusive lock on wbxdata ... bishop brews lvcWebJul 5, 2015 · Here my ideas: if tables have datetime column -> create new master + new child -> insert new data to NEW + OLD (ex: datetime = 2015-07-06 00:00:00) -> copy … dark green aesthetic colorWeb9 rows · 3.1. Partition name vs. Table name. Historically, the name that one specifies in the ... bishop brian david mooreWebTo add a new column to a table, you use ALTER TABLE ADD COLUMN statement: ALTER TABLE table_name ADD COLUMN column_name datatype column_constraint; Code language: SQL (Structured Query Language) (sql) To drop a column from a table, you use ALTER TABLE DROP COLUMN statement: ALTER TABLE table_name DROP … bishop brennan fresno